## Handover Note — Director Transition, Peralt to Winsome

The new Lumera Plus subscription tier launches next quarter. Pricing is locked, packaging is final, and the billing migration on Corefleet is two sprints from done. Outstanding items: churn modeling for the legacy tier, partner notifications, and the support staffing plan. Heads of department have draft comms ready but should hold until launch week. One open risk: annual-plan grandfathering remains unresolved. Context for that decision sits in the confidential note below.

board note of hawip-tajof: Project Eliix slips by one quarter because of the supplier delay.

Attendees: coordination desk and the metrology team lead. Topic: the batch of calibration weights returning from Ambervale Standards Lab. Weights are certified and boxed in numbered cases; any dropped case voids certification, so one driver, direct route, no consolidation with other loads. Cases must remain strapped upright and the vehicle should avoid the unpaved Kettleford bypass. Delivery window is 13:00–15:00 at the Norrow Street lab entrance. At hand-over, the courier receives the instruction below.

handover note for tafog-bawef: the ulair kasael courier leaves the ralok gilmir fenael druwyn feneth queniel belix keliel ledger at gate 5216 under passcode 961436

## Deployment

Plugins built for the Quillmark renderer must vendor any third-party fonts rather than fetching them at runtime; the sandbox blocks outbound requests during render. Place font files under your plugin's assets directory and declare each family in your manifest so the Quillmark packager can subset and embed them at build time. Unsubsetted fonts will be rejected by the publishing gate, so verify licensing metadata is present. The packager's font pipeline runs with the following configuration values, which you should not override:

service settings:
[silwyn]
host = silwyn.crelvogrid.internal
user = silwyn_svc
database = silwyn_prod